2.5 stars.
I know I shouldn't go into a book with high expectations, but it happens. I think even if I didn't have high expectations I would have been a bit disappointed.
I'm just not sure what it was missing or what my issue with it was. I liked the idea but it seemed really really familiar. I know that a lot of books are similar but the first half of Six of Crows just screamed Mistborn. Seriously Kaz and Kelsier where way to similar!!! And now this reminds me of The Magicians Guild or Apprentice (I can't remember the title), that just doesn't sit so well with me.
It's a quick read and I'll see what happens in the next book, but if I didn't already own the trilogy, I probably wouldn't go out of my way to pick it up.
